Otter.ai is an AI meeting assistant that joins calls to transcribe, summarise and capture action items in real time. Its OtterPilot can automatically attend Zoom, Meet and Teams meetings, generating searchable notes and highlights. Otter is widely used by teams who want accurate, automatic meeting records.

Fireflies.ai is an AI notetaker that records, transcribes and analyses meetings across major conferencing platforms. Beyond transcripts, it offers conversation analytics, topic tracking and CRM integrations aimed at sales and customer teams. Fireflies turns every call into searchable, actionable data.

Zapier AI layers natural-language automation on top of Zapier's connections to thousands of apps. You can describe a workflow in plain English to build a Zap, or deploy AI agents and chatbots that take actions across your tools. It turns Zapier from a no-code automation tool into an AI-orchestration platform.

Claude is Anthropic's family of AI assistants, known for long-context reasoning, careful writing and strong coding ability. The Opus, Sonnet and Haiku tiers let you trade off intelligence, speed and cost. Claude excels at nuanced analysis, document understanding and agentic coding workflows, and is a favourite among developers and writers who value clarity.

Gemini is Google's natively multimodal model family, deeply integrated across Search, Workspace, Android and the Pixel line. Its standout feature is an enormous context window of up to one to two million tokens, ideal for analysing long videos, codebases and document sets. Gemini blends Google's real-time knowledge with strong reasoning and is available free in many products.

Perplexity is an AI answer engine that combines live web search with large language models to deliver cited, up-to-date answers. Instead of a blank chat, it returns sourced summaries with follow-up questions, making it a popular replacement for traditional search. Pro mode taps frontier models and deeper research, and its API exposes the same search-grounded answers.

Make (formerly Integromat) is a visual automation platform whose flowchart-style builder makes complex, branching workflows easy to design. With AI modules and connections to thousands of apps, it powers sophisticated automations that go beyond simple triggers. Make appeals to power users who want granular control over their automation logic.
